'Always People First’: PM Modi Lauds FM's Decision To Slash Excise Duty On Petrol, Diesel

“Today’s decisions, especially the one relating to a significant drop in petrol and diesel prices will positively impact various sectors,” said Prime Minister Narendra Modi.

New Delhi: Reacting to the announcement of slash in central excise duty for petrol and diesel by Union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man, Prime Minister Narendra Modi said that for his government people are always “first”.

Sitharaman made a series of announcements on Twitter which included a cut in central excise duty on petrol and diesel. Excise duty has been reduced by Rs 8 per litre on petrol and Rs 6 per litre on diesel. “This will reduce the price of petrol by ₹ 9.5 per litre and of Diesel by ₹ 7 per litre,” said Sitharaman. 

Sharing her tweet, PM Modi wrote, “Today’s decisions, especially the one relating to a significant drop in petrol and diesel prices will positively impact various sectors.” 

He further said that the decisions will “provide relief to our citizens and further Ease of Living.”

PM Modi also reacted to the announcement of providing a subsidy of Rs 200 under the PM Ujjawala Yoajana saying that the scheme “has helped crores of Indians, especially women.” 

“Today’s decision on Ujjwala subsidy will greatly ease family budgets,” he added. 

Among other decisions announced by the Union Finance Minister includes reduction in custom duty on raw materials & intermediaries for plastic products where our import dependence is high and on customs duty on raw materials & intermediaries for iron & steel.

 Import duty on some raw materials of steel will also be reduced.
